About The Pucking Wrong Rookie by C.R. Jane (The Pucking Wrong Series, Book 5 of 5) – A Dark Hockey Romance About Obsession, Risk and Finding Something Real
Sloane has learned to survive by keeping her feelings locked away. She lives in a world controlled by rich and powerful men, where getting emotionally attached can make life more dangerous. Then Logan York sees her in the crowd at the Stanley Cup Finals, and the wall around her heart begins to crack.
Logan is the Dallas Knights’ rookie sensation. He is young, famous, confident, and completely sure about one thing: he wants Sloane. After pulling her into his arms following the first game of the Finals, he refuses to treat their kiss as meaningless. Sloane says she will not date him. Logan finds another way to stay close.
The Pucking Wrong Rookie by C.R. Jane is a dark hockey romance built around obsession, attraction, danger, and a woman who does not easily trust love. Podium lists it as Book 5 of The Pucking Wrong Series and describes it as a darkly seductive hockey romance centered on Sloane and Logan York.
Sloane Has Learned That Feelings Can Be Dangerous
Sloane does not begin this story looking for romance. Her life has taught her to protect herself by feeling as little as possible. She survives by keeping emotional distance between herself and the men around her.
Logan changes that balance.
He does not simply notice Sloane. He becomes focused on her. His attention is bold, intense, and difficult to escape. Sloane knows that getting close to him could make her life more complicated, so she tries to keep him in the same safe box as everyone else.
For readers who enjoy heroines with difficult pasts and strong emotional walls, Sloane’s struggle gives the romance more weight than a simple meet-cute.
Logan York Plays to Win Off the Ice Too
Logan is not written as a gentle, perfect romance hero. He is a morally grey character whose feelings quickly become possessive and obsessive.
When Sloane refuses to date him, he does not simply walk away. After learning more about the life she has been forced to live, he decides he wants to get her out of it. His solution is extreme: he hires her himself, giving him a reason to stay close while trying to prove that he wants more than her body.
That setup creates the dark tension at the center of the book. Logan wants Sloane’s trust, attention, and eventually her heart, while Sloane is used to men wanting something from her.
Readers who like possessive hockey heroes, obsessive devotion, morally grey choices, and high emotional intensity will find those elements central to the story.
More Than a Typical Sports Romance
Hockey is an important part of Logan’s world, but this is not a light sports romance about cute arena moments.
The story mixes professional hockey with darker adult romance themes. Logan is an NHL rookie playing for the Dallas Knights, and the Stanley Cup Finals set the stage for his first major connection with Sloane. Much of the emotional story, however, happens away from the ice.
Sloane’s past and Logan’s extreme reaction to what he learns create much of the conflict. The hockey setting brings fame, competition, money, and public attention, while the romance explores power, trust, desire, and obsession.
A Standalone Story Inside the Pucking Wrong World
The Pucking Wrong Rookie is listed as Book 5 in C.R. Jane’s Pucking Wrong Series, but it is also presented as a standalone hockey romance. Readers can focus on Logan and Sloane’s relationship without needing every earlier book to understand their main story.
Returning readers still get the fun of coming back to the wider hockey-romance world. The series is known for morally grey hockey players who become intensely focused on the women they want.
Know the Tone Before You Start
This book is best suited to adult readers who are comfortable with dark romance.
The story includes an obsessive and possessive hero, a strong power imbalance, mature sexual content, difficult past experiences, and behavior that may cross normal relationship boundaries. Logan is intentionally presented as morally grey rather than as a model of healthy real-life dating behavior.
Readers who want a soft, realistic, low-drama romance may prefer something else. Readers who enjoy fictional antiheroes, extreme devotion, dark relationship dynamics, hockey romance, and high-stakes attraction are much closer to the intended audience.
Why Readers May Get Hooked on Sloane and Logan
The main attraction is the contrast between them.
Sloane survives by shutting feelings down. Logan feels everything at full force. She wants distance. He wants forever. She sees danger in caring. He decides that winning her heart is the one goal he will not give up.
There is also a strong rescue fantasy inside the romance. Once Logan understands the situation Sloane is trapped in, he wants to remove every threat around her. His methods are not always reasonable or gentle, which keeps him firmly in morally grey territory.
For dark-romance readers, that mix of danger and devotion can create a fast, emotional reading experience.
